William Smith lacrosse edges Cortland to remain unbeaten

William Smith lacrosse held off Cortland 10-9 on Saturday evening at Grady Field, improving to 3-0 on the season with a late fourth-quarter goal.

Kira Fulton led the Herons with four goals, while Delaney Cassidy and Grace Rund each scored twice. Rund also controlled seven draw controls, including the possession that led to the game-winning goal. Luly Kuhn contributed three caused turnovers and four ground balls for William Smith.

Cortland scored 43 seconds into the game, but the Herons answered with a free-position goal to tie the contest before Brooke Elizalde restored the Red Dragons’ lead. The teams traded opportunities through the opening quarter before William Smith gained momentum in the second period, scoring three times to take a 5-4 lead into halftime.

Cortland surged ahead early in the third quarter with three straight goals to move in front 7-5. Cassidy cut the deficit with a free-position goal late in the period to pull the Herons within one entering the fourth.

William Smith regained control early in the final quarter as Fulton scored twice in the opening five minutes to give the Herons an 8-7 advantage. Cortland responded with two goals to reclaim a 9-8 lead with just over six minutes remaining.

Rund won the ensuing draw, and Cassidy tied the game at 9-9 on a free-position opportunity with 4:42 left. Another draw control by Rund set up the decisive moment when she scored the go-ahead goal with 3:41 remaining. The Herons forced a turnover on Cortland’s final possession and ran out the clock.
